Abstract
I will discuss BPS limits of M-theory that lead to U-dual webs of decoupled theories, whose fundamental degrees of freedom are described by matrix theories. All these BPS limits are organized by five different duality orbits of M-theory in DLCQs. Via a generalization of the TTbar deformation to p-branes, this leads to a classification of holographic constructions in string theory. I will show that non-Lorentzian geometric techniques play an indispensable role in this framework. By examining the fundamental strings in these decoupled theories, I will argue how Lorentzian supergravity arises from the corner associated with the IKKT matrix theory and how non-Lorentzian supergravities arise from other T-dual corners, including the one associated with the BFSS matrix theory.
